Colors. Labrador Retriever is a breed. Chocolate, Yellow and Black are merely colors (and are the ONLY colors). Breeding any two other colors will usually produce puppies of all three colors. Chocolates are actually no different in personality than other Labs and are not genetically different at all from the other two colors.
I am passing along the lecture that Mugen's breeder gave me when I asked her about this common misconception because I'd heard it from several people when I mentioned that we might be getting a chocolate Lab. I'd asked her in jest, but what she said, both surprised me... and didn't surprise me.
Sadly, chocolates went through a period where they became the "fashionable" dog to have. They got overbred and poorly bred by a lot of back yard breeders and puppy mills, so the perception that Chocolate labs are more energetic is merely perpetuated by the fact that the Chocolates most people have experience with... were bred only for their color, not for temperament, not for health and not for any other reason aside from the fact that they were chocolate.
Yeah, I know, it's stupid... but it's the truth.
Mugen's parents were sooo laid back and eager to please that I was happy to purchase a puppy from their litter. He will not be any more hyper than any other Lab I have owned, in fact, it is very likely that he will be LESS hyper than most other Labs because he's an English bred dog and the Lab that most people have become familiar with are American dogs from field lines. Field dogs are taller and leaner and have more energy than English dogs, which are shorter, but stockier and less high strung.
But I do relate to what you've said about your Lab mix. Labs keep their "puppy bounce" for their entire lives. A Labrador Retriever doesn't actually reach maturity until they are 3 years old. They don't finish growing completely for 2 years. They'll attain MOST of their size in one year, but they will finish growing into their feet and fill out their bone structure during that second year, so it's important to maintain a high protein diet of good fats in order to promote healthy growth.
